MID-WEST FANTASY FAN FEDERATIONfrom Fancyclopedia 2
An organization of states in the American Mid-West, formed at the
Michiconference in 1941, which set up the Illinois Fantasy Fan Federation
(replacing the Illinois Fantasy Fictioneers), Michigan ditto, Indiana ditto,
and Ohio ditto. In 1942 tentacles took in the MFS and
Smarje's Midwest Fan Society. The state organizations had practically no
activity and consisted mostly of "locals" of one or two people. The MWFFF
itself had little function aside from holding the Michi[gan]conference. But
this regional setup inspired the ill-starred Battle Creek Plan that brought
on an N3F interregnum.
